Orlando Magic Host 2014 Summer Camps Presented by UnitedHealthCare

Orlando, Fla. – The Orlando Magic will host over 20 basketball camps, designed for boys and girls of all skill levels ages 7-16, across Central Florida this summer. Registration is officially open and limited space is still available for all sessions.

In addition to the 19 day camps, the Magic are hosting an overnight camp from June 29-July 3 at Warner University in Lake Wales, Fla., which includes all meals and housing. Due to popular demand, a one-day “Mini Camp” returns for youth ages 4-8 at the RDV Sportsplex on July 19 from 9 a.m.-Noon, and, for the first time, the TNBA/Magic Academy Challenge comes to the Orlando area with two editions being held July 7-9 and August 4-6 at the Jewish Community Center in Maitland. This intense program, designed for advanced players ages 13-18 and limited to just 30 participants per session, features elite-level training methods and combine-inspired drills.

The Orlando Magic and UnitedHealthcare are providing 100 kids with full scholarships to attend camps. For more information and to apply for a scholarship, visit www.OrlandoMagic.com/CampScholarship . Scholarships will be awarded on a first-come, first-served basis pending availability of preferred camp and proof of need-based eligibility.

Each camp session offers expert instruction provided by the National Basketball Academy, personalized attention with a coach (no greater than a 1:10 coach-to-camper ratio), drills, skill development, live games, complimentary Gatorade and an individual player evaluation. All participants will receive an official camp T-shirt, full-size Magic basketball, commemorative certificate of achievement and a ticket to a 2014-15 Orlando Magic home game in the Amway Center. In addition, all campers will have the opportunity to participate in contests and games and each camp features an awards ceremony. Guest appearances by current and former Magic players (subject to availability) are also a highlight at select sessions.
